Warning Signs You Need Odor Removal After Water Damage in Groton, MA

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and further damage. Catch these signs early to prevent bigger problems: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ice a persistent, unpleasant smell in your property,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ains can show water damage or leaks. If you notice water stains on your walls or ceilings, it’s crucial to inspect the area and address any underlying issues.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show water damage or excessive moisture. If you notice any changes in your paint or wallpaper, it’s crucial to inspect the area and address any underlying issues.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can be a sign of water damage or hidden issues. If you notice any unusual noises or leaks,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Odor Removal After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water spill with no visible damage Yes No You can handle minor spills with cleaning products and drying techniques.
Visible water damage with musty odors No Yes Hidden moisture and odors need professional equipment and techniques to detect and remove.
Water damage with structural issues No Yes Structural issues need professional expertise to repair and ensure safety.
Large-scale water damage with extensive cleanup No Yes Large-scale water damage needs professional equipment and techniques to ensure thorough cleanup and restoration.
Hidden mold growth with musty odors No Yes Hidden mold growth needs professional equipment and techniques to detect and remove safely.
Water damage with insurance claims involved No Yes Insurance claims need professional documentation and evidence of damage to ensure a smooth process.

Q: What causes musty odors after water damage?

A: Musty odors after water damage are typically caused by hidden moisture and mold growth. Our team uses advanced equipment and techniques to detect and remove hidden moisture and odors, ensuring your property is completely dry and free of musty smells.

Q: Can I use cleaning products to remove odors after water damage?

A: While cleaning products can help mask odors, they may not completely remove hidden moisture and odors. Our team uses specialized equipment and techniques to detect and remove hidden odors and moisture, ensuring your property is completely restored.
